[Denmark] Phd Posistion in Veterinary Epidemiology and Virology at Technical University of Denmark
A 3 year PhD position in veterinary epidemiology and virology is available at the National Veterinary Institute (DTU).
The successful candidate will be placed at the National Veterinary Institute, Copenhagen, to work in the Section for Veterinary Epidemiology and Public Sector Consultancy, and will work for about 1 year at the Division of Virology, Lindholm Island between Moen and Zealand (near Kalvehave). The project is conducted in collaboration with the Danish Cattle Federation.
Job description The overall aim of the PhD project is to optimize the surveillance of serious infections in cattle taking the structural development of the Danish cattle industry into account, leading to fewer but larger herds. This is to be done by 1) making effective use of existing data on health and production parameters on the animal and herd level to allow a risk based surveillance approach and 2) by increasing the sensitivity of the surveillance system by validating and improving the diagnostic procedures for screening of pooled bulk milk samples and 3) optimizing the performance of the surveillance program to ensure that it is focused on high risk animals/herds, can be used for early warning and is cost/effective. Bovine viral diarrhoea (BVD) is used in the project as an example. BVD has been eradicated in the Danish cattle population during the last 15 years. The present surveillance system is based on bulk-milk-analysis which was validated using considerably smaller herds with a higher percentage of antibody positive lactating cows. The present situation where only a few cows may have antibodies need new considerations of how to collect samples and how to analyse them to have a cost effective and sensitive system.

[Australia] PhD Research Scholarship in Asia-Pacific Studies at University of Wollongong
PhD Research Scholarship in Asia-Pacific Studies at University of Wollongong
Two scholarships are available for PhD research to commence in Semester 1, 2010. The scholarships are associated with Professor Vera Mackie`s ARC Future Fellowship Project on Human Rights in the Asia-Pacific Region. Applicants should have a first-class honours degree with a specialisation in Asia-Pacific studies. Language skills from the region to be studied would be an advantage. Possible topics include a study of human rights in a specific country in the region, or a thematic study such as sexuality and human rights or indigeneity and human rights.

[USA] PhD Student in General Linguistics at University of Texas at Arlington
PhD Student in General Linguistics at University of Texas at Arlington
Institution/ Organization: The University of Texas at Arlington Department: Linguistics & TESOL Web Address: http://ling. uta.edu Level: PhD Duties: Teaching Specialty Areas: General Linguistics
Description: The Department of Linguistics & TESOL at The University of Texas at Arlington would like to announce the availability of five assistantships for new students admitted for study in our PhD program starting in Fall 2010. These graduate teaching assistantships will have a 9 month stipend of $15,300 and cover tuition for 9 hours of coursework a semester (9 hours is a full-time load).
[The Netherlands] PhD Position in Climate Research and Seismology at Global Climate of the Royal Netherlands Meteorological Institute
PhD Position in Climate Research and Seismology at Global Climate of the Royal Netherlands Meteorological Institute
Within the sector of Climate research and Seismology, department Global Climate of the Royal Netherlands Meteorological Institute (KNMI) we offer a PhD position.
General information KNMI (www.knmi.nl) is the national institute for weather and climate change in the Netherlands. The Climate Research department focuses on understanding and predicting climate change. The section global climate in particular addresses the fundamental processes related to climate change and modeling of these processes. Understanding nonlinear climate change and decadal climate variations and developing scenarios for such variations are key issues in this department.
Job information The Netherlands Organization for Scientific Research (NWO)-program Feedbacks in the Climate System has funded the project `How the Meridional Overturning Circulation interacts with climate: cause and effect of variations in the sinking of deep water.` The Atlantic Meridional Overturning Circulation (MOC; sometimes identified with the Warm Gulf Stream), transports large amounts of heat from the subtropics to more northerly regions. Multi-annual fluctuations in the MOC have a significant influence on European climate. Because the ocean is a relatively `slow` system, with a memory of many years to centuries, climate prediction is possible once the initial state of the MOC is known. A further demand, however, is that climate models correctly simulate the evolution of the MOC and the interaction between MOC and climate. Because the MOC is badly constrained by observations, the evolution of the MOC in climate models is hardly validated. We suggest a new strategy to validate the MOC/climate interaction and to assess model biases. Recently, a theory on the mechanism of the sinking of deep water, that is, the downwelling branch of the MOC was developed. With the aid of scaling laws and budget analysis one can assess whether models give an accurate description of the downwelling branch of the MOC.
